Why Chattanooga businesses are losing leads to out-of-town competitors

I audit Chattanooga sites every week. The pattern is consistent. A logistics SaaS founder ships a marketing site that looks like it was built in 2018. A Hamilton County clinic runs a contact form with five required fields and no booking link. A downtown restaurant group spreads three brands across four templated WordPress installs and wonders why none of them rank. Meanwhile, an agency from Atlanta or Nashville parachutes in with a custom Webflow build and eats their lunch on “logistics software Chattanooga” or “best medspa Lookout Mountain.”

The leads aren’t disappearing. They’re being intercepted. Search behavior in Chattanooga skews mobile-heavy because of the tourism overlay, and mobile searchers bounce off slow, templated sites in under 4 seconds. If your Largest Contentful Paint is over 2.5 seconds, you’re losing roughly a third of the people who tap your result before they’ve seen your headline. I’ve measured this on real Chattanooga sites. The numbers don’t lie.

Add to that the GBP problem. Most Chattanooga businesses I’ve reviewed have a Google Business Profile that hasn’t been updated in 60 days, fewer than 10 reviews per quarter, and no booking link. In 2026, those three signals alone explain most Map Pack ranking gaps. Google has explicitly weighted recency, velocity, and direct-booking ability higher in the local algorithm. A stale profile with 400 old reviews loses to a fresh profile with 60 recent ones, every time.

Five wins I’d ship for a Chattanooga business in the first 90 days

1. A hero section that loads in under 2 seconds on 4G

The hero is the entire game on mobile. I rebuild it custom, ship it as pre-rendered HTML/CSS, defer everything else, and target Largest Contentful Paint under 2 seconds on a throttled 4G connection. For a Chattanooga logistics SaaS founder, that’s the difference between a Series-A buyer reading your headline and a Series-A buyer hitting back.

2. A Google Business Profile that ranks in the 3-pack across Hamilton County

I optimize the primary category, fill all 9 secondaries, write a keyword-and-neighborhood-aware 750-character description, upload 30+ fresh photos, set up Reserve-with-Google or direct booking, and start a weekly post cadence. Within 60-90 days, most clients see Local Falcon grid coverage shift from amber to green across central Chattanooga.

3. Service pages that beat the templated competition on intent

If you’re a healthcare clinic, I build one page per service: not a single “Services” page with 12 accordion items. Each service page targets a real local query, runs full Service schema, includes pricing or starting-at copy, and ends with a direct booking link. This alone moves most Chattanooga clinics from page 2 to page 1 for their top 5 services in 90 days.

4. Schema that earns AI Overview citations

AI Overview and Perplexity-style search are now a measurable share of branded and unbranded traffic in 2026. I add LocalBusiness, Service, FAQPage, and Organization schema to every page I build. Then I pre-seed the FAQ block with the exact questions Chattanooga customers ask, so the AI engines have a clean source to cite. Most of the local sites I’ve audited have zero schema. Adding it correctly is a free win.

5. A lead-capture flow that doesn’t feel like a contact form

I kill the 5-field contact form on day one. I replace it with a 2-step capture (name + email, then phone + best-time-to-call after submit) plus a Calendly or Reserve-with-Google embed. Capture rates roughly double in my historical data. For a Chattanooga clinic doing 20 inbound leads per month, that’s 20 more booked consults per month at zero ad-spend lift.

Local SEO checklist for Chattanooga businesses

This is the exact checklist I run for every Chattanooga client in the first 30 days. If you want me to run it for you, book a call. If you want to DIY, work through it line by line.

  1. Claim and verify your Google Business Profile, including the new video verification flow if Google triggers it.
  2. Confirm your business name exactly matches your legal name on Tennessee Secretary of State records. No keyword stuffing.
  3. Set your single best primary category (this is ~14% of ranking weight).
  4. Fill all 9 secondary categories that genuinely match your services.
  5. Set service area to Chattanooga, Hixson, Red Bank, East Ridge, Soddy-Daisy, Signal Mountain, Lookout Mountain, Ooltewah, and Hamilton County.
  6. Add a local Chattanooga phone number (a 423 area code outperforms toll-free for local trust).
  7. Add your website URL with UTM tagging (`utm_source=gbp`) so you can measure GBP-driven sessions in GA4.
  8. Write a 750-character “from the business” description with “Chattanooga” and your primary service in the first sentence.
  9. Upload 30+ photos: 10 exterior, 10 interior, 10 team or work-in-progress.
  10. Add all services with descriptions and starting prices where regulation permits.
  11. Set up Reserve-with-Google or a direct booking link (this is a 2026 ranking signal).
  12. Post 2x per week minimum: updates, offers, events, FAQs. Use natural Chattanooga-specific language, not keyword spam.
  13. Respond to every review within 24 hours, target 80%+ response rate. Use the customer’s first name, the service, and the city in 5-star responses.
  14. Build a review-request flow that goes out by SMS post-service (SMS converts 4x email).
  15. Submit to the top 25 citations: Tier 1 data aggregators (Bing Places, Apple Maps, Yelp, Foursquare, Data Axle, Localeze, BBB, YP), Tier 2 directories (Manta, Chamber of Commerce, Citysearch, Hotfrog, Brownbook), and Tier 3 vertical citations specific to your industry.
  16. Get listed on the Chattanooga Chamber of Commerce, Tennessee Aquarium business directory, and any neighborhood association sites (North Shore, Southside, St. Elmo).
  17. Build 2 local backlinks per month: sponsorships, local press, Chattanooga Times Free Press business briefs, partnership pages on related Chattanooga businesses.
  18. Run a monthly Local Falcon grid scan across 5×5 (city core) and 7×7 (Hamilton County) to track Map Pack movement.
  19. Add LocalBusiness, Service, FAQPage, and Organization schema to every page on your site, matching GBP NAP exactly.
  20. Audit and remove any duplicate listings (the #1 NAP-consistency killer in 2026).
